Step-by-step explanation:

Step 1: Define

9.27 mol O₂ (Oxygen)

Step 2: Identify Conversions

Avogadro's Number

Step 3: Convert

  1. Set up:
    \displaystyle 9.27 \ mol \ O_2((6.022 \cdot 10^(23) \ molecules \ O_2)/(1 \ mol \ O_2))
  2. Multiply/Divide:
    \displaystyle 5.58239 \cdot 10^(24) \ molecules \ O_2

Step 4: Check

Follow sig fig rules. We are given 3 sig figs.

5.58239 × 10²⁴ molecules O₂ ≈ 5.58 × 10²⁴ molecules O₂
